Shades of White, a worldwide peace and family strengthening initiative, was founded in 2009 by Qasim ibn Ali Khan, of Houston, Texas.

The World Health Organization (WHO) reports that currently, of the estimated 200,000.000 orphaned children worldwide, nearly 150,000 documented orphans are right here in the United States. In spite of the many American families who are adopting children, the number of children without permanent homes continue to increase.

It is sad to also note that most of these orphans have reached the age of puberty, as most adoptive parents seem to gravitate towards infants and toddlers, a choice that may very well be indirectly connected to the rise in crime in the inner cities of America, as too many adolescent orphans grow into adulthood and react to a complex of feeling unwanted and expendable.

In an effort to respond to this, Shades of White is about to launch "Operation Orphans Rights", an initiative aimed at serving notice to America that all citizens, particularly those of civic influence should immediately begin to more actively promote the institution of adoption and foster care in preparation for adoption of homeless children of all ages. "Operation Orphans Rights" also promotes the linking of the families who have the finances but dont have the time...with the families who have the time, but dont have the finances.

Various faith based and civic leaders are banding together for the official launch of this critical campaign to raise public awareness, and put the orphans of America in the front of our minds.
